Chaperone and anti‐chaperone: Two‐faced synuclein as stimulator of synaptic evolution

Explore this paper's citation graph

Summary

The intriguing possibility that the dual syn proteins might have acquired a driving force for synaptic evolution is referred to, whereby the anti‐chaperone syn may provoke stress‐induced diverse responses, whereas, the chaperones may provide buffering for them, allowing accumulation of nonlethal phenotypic variations in synapses.
